All You Need to Know about a Las Vegas, Nevada, Realtor

from:

A Las Vegas, Nevada realtor is going to be a very busy person because Las Vegas grows by fifty thousand residents every year. Las Vegas has been very popular to residents, but also to corporations because there are special tax breaks available to corporations. They do not have to pay corporate income or franchise taxes. There are also no inventory taxes charged to businesses. Businesses don’t even have to pay unitary taxes. There are many, many perks for businesses interested in moving to Las Vegas. Plenty of perks are leading to plenty of corporate relocations. Plenty of corporate relocations naturally lead to private relocations. According to the US Census, every twenty-four hours, another two acres of Las Vegas, Nevada is developed. This happens every day of the year. The Las Vegas, Nevada realtor is in a real gold mine as a result.

According to the Las Vegas Chamber of Commerce, two and a half million tourists visit Las Vegas every month, and six thousand new residents arrive to keep a Las Vegas Nevada realtor on his or her toes. Part of the reason for this population growth is because Las Vegas has one of the lowest unemployment rates in the US. In fact, according to the Arizona State University Economic Outlook Center, Las Vegas has continually been the leading city in the US in employment growth since 1995.
